What Makes For A Nice Selfie Phone On Diwali

Before we get to the list, we should take a moment to discuss the things that might help turn a good selfie into a freaking awesome one, especially during Diwali. An above-average megapixel count for the front-facing camera guarantees crisper shots, even when cropped or zoomed in upon, while later fiddling with that oh-so-perfect shot. A bigger aperture setting improves the condition of low-light pictures taken for diyas and nighttime decorations. Checklist items include night mode, beauty filters, skin tone corrections, and, for good measure, some nice bright screen flash. Altogether, with some of these features, your selfies will shine through in low festive light.

Motorola Edge 50 Fusion has a 32-megapixel front camera, which works decently even in low-light conditions. So particularly suited for the Diwali festivities when light and decoration fluctuate from one moment to the other. Just for its AMOLED display, smooth flesh of UI, and moderate picture clarity, this phone is worth your investment of around ₹20,999.
